Overview
Listed Building Works are mainly limited to The Pickwick Room and its small anti-room (The Reading Room). Also partial re-decoration in the corridor running along the west side of the Pickwick Room. No redecoration of the outside of the three room doors (which are wood-grained). Access will be required to install the air-conditioning unit in the plant space above the small kitchen and the heat exchanger will be mounted in the open-air shaft behind the kitchen area.
